牛津词典
noun
- 雇佣兵
a soldier who will fight for any country or group that offers payment- foreign mercenaries
外国雇佣兵 - mercenary soldiers
雇佣兵
- foreign mercenaries
adj.
- 只为金钱的
only interested in making or getting money- a mercenary society/attitude
唯利是图的社会 / 态度 - She's interested in him for purely mercenary reasons.
她对他感兴趣完全是为了贪图金钱。

柯林斯词典
- (外籍)雇佣兵
Amercenaryis a soldier who is paid to fight by a country or group that they do not belong to. - 唯利是图的;见钱眼开的
If you describe someone asmercenary, you are criticizing them because you think that they are only interested in the money that they can get from a particular person or situation.
